#101ad2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#101ad2 is composed of 6.3% red, 10.2%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.4%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 236.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 44.3%. #101ad2 color hex could be obtained by blending #2034ff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#101ad2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#101ad2 has RGB values of R:16, G:26,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1055442.

Shades and Tints of #101ad2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010a is the darkest color, while #f6f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#101ad2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707072 is the less saturated color, while #0712db is the most saturated one.
